Penang to swear in 40 assemblymen on Aug 29

GEORGE TOWN, Aug 25 — All 40 Penang assemblymen are set to take their oath of office on August 29 at the Penang State Legislative Assembly building here, said Chief Minister Chow Kon Yeow.

He said the swearing-in for all 40 assemblymen is subject to a notice handed to the Yang di-Pertua Negeri Tun Ahmad Fuzi Abdul Razak for consent.

Earlier, Chow officiated the STEM Showcase 2023 ceremony in conjunction with the state-level National Science Week 2023 at Han Chiang High School, which was also attended by Science, Technology and Innovation Minister Chang Lih Kang.

In the August 12 state polls, the Pakatan Harapan (Harapan)-Barisan Nasional alliance won 29 seats while Perikatan Nasional grabbed 11 seats, following which Penang Harapan chairman Chow was sworn in as chief minister.

On August 16, 10 Penang executive councillors took their oath of office before the Yang di-Pertua Negeri at Dewan Sri Pinang.
